Humidity Mold Incubator

The humidity and mold incubator maintains a constant temperature and humidity environment within a sealed space through its temperature and humidity control system, enabling the germination and growth of mold spores. It is used to test the anti-mold performance of materials, conduct microbial cultivation experiments, and evaluate the resistance of products to mold in industries such as papermaking and coatings.
Selection
When selecting, focus on the temperature and humidity control accuracy and uniformity. The chamber material must be corrosion-resistant and easy to clean. Determine the inner chamber size based on sample capacity, and ensure it has UV sterilization functionality to prevent cross-contamination. Consider daily maintenance costs and equipment stability to meet the requirements of standard testing cycles.

Operation Specification for Circular Scratch Adhesion Tester
The circle method adhesion tester is used to evaluate the adhesion strength between coatings and substrates. Before operation, it is necessary to inspect the instrument, prepare samples, and control the ambient temperature and humidity. During testing, the sample should be secured, appropriate load and scratch spacing should be selected, and the stylus should be moved at a constant speed to create a circular scratch.
